1 Types of Chemical Reactions Chem Ch 11

2 5 general types of chemical reactions 1. Combination 2. Decomposition 3. Single Replacement 4. Double Replacement 5. Combustion

3 Combination Reaction Two or more chemicals combine to make one product. Sulfur + oxygen  sulfur dioxide Hydrogen + oxygen  water

6 Decomposition reaction- the reverse of Combination One chemical reactant breaks into two or more products H 2 O (l)  H 2 (g) + O 2 (g) 2HgO (s)  2 Hg (l) + O 2 (g)

8 Single Replacement Reactions See the reactivity series of metals table 11.2 page 333 The metal at the top of the list will replace metals below it in single replacement reactions. Lithium Potassium Calcium Sodium Magnesium Aluminum Zinc Iron Lead Hydrogen ion (H + ) Copper Mercury Silver

9 Single Replacement Reactions 2Na (s) + 2H 2 0 (l)  2NaOH (s) + H 2 (g) Lithium Potassium Calcium Sodium Magnesium Aluminum Zinc Iron Lead Hydrogen ion (H + ) Copper Mercury Silver

13 Double Replacement reaction A chemical change involving an exchange of positive ions between two ions. AgNO 3 (aq) + NaCl (aq)  AgCl (s) + NaNO 3 (aq)

16 A double replacement reaction will be noticed when a precipitate is formed for one of the products See the Solubility Rules on page 344 Table 11.3 or the handouts provided.

17 Combustion Reactions A combustion reaction is a special type of Combination reaction. A combustion reaction occurs when a fuel or a metal reacts with Oxygen. If the fuel is organic, the products normally include CO 2 and H 2 O.

18 Examples of Combustion Reactions (unbalanced) H 2 (g) + O 2 (g)  H 2 O (l) Mg (s) + O 2 (g)  MgO (s)

19 Examples of Combustion Reactions (unbalanced) Al (s) + O 2 (g)  Al 2 O 3 (s) C 3 H 8 (g) + O 2 (g)  CO 2 (g) + H 2 O (g)

20 Examples of Combustion Reactions (unbalanced) C (s) + O 2 (g)  CO 2 (g) CO (g) + O 2 (g)  CO 2 (g)
